I made one like this. I did mine all in reds and pinks. I started it early in January of this year. It was to be done and out for Valentine's Day. I quilted finally in November. It is now waiting for binding. It is really big. I cut a bunch of fabric before I started. I cut so much the quilt wound up being 110" x 98" Sheesh it is big and very heavy! I will post a picture when I finally finish it.
